The centenary of Benjamin Britten's birth falls this coming November and to mark Britten Year, a couple of new biographies have been published. Paul Kildea's Benjamin Britten: A Life in the Twentieth Century has just been published by Penguin; James Jolly talks to Paul Kildea about Britten in this first 'Gramophone Milestones Podcast', produced in association with EFG International, the private bank for classical music.

Musical excerpts come from Britten's extensive catalogue for Decca who are gathering together the Complete Works for release in time for this year's Aldeburgh Festival.
